Bengaluru North City Corporation Commissioner Shri Pommala Sunil Kumar has instructed officials to ensure prompt resolution of citizen complaints received during the weekly Phone-In Programme, which continues to see strong public participation.



Key Details:
- Commissioner directly interacted with citizens during the Phone-In Programme held at the Commissioner’s Office Hall on Amruthahalli Main Road
- Programme conducted on April 17, 2026, starting at 7:00 AM
- 51 calls received, registering a total of 61 grievances
- Officials instructed to take immediate action on all complaints
Key Issues Reported:
- Road conditions and potholes: 26 complaints
- Waste management: 13 complaints
- Stray dog issues: 5 complaints
- Streetlight maintenance: 4 complaints
- Tree branch trimming: 3 requests
Progress Overview:
- Total grievances since September 26: 1,690
- Resolved: 1,240
- Pending: 322 (directed for early resolution)
- Complaints related to other departments forwarded accordingly
Programme Details:
- Conducted weekly every Friday
- Initiative aimed at direct grievance redressal
- Positive public response reported
